Google Unveils Earth AI Tool for Nature Restoration

New deep learning technology maps small ecological features to boost biodiversity on global agricultural lands.

Google Research has developed Earth AI, a high-resolution deep learning framework for nature restoration [1]. The technology detects fine-scale ecological features, such as hedgerows, that standard satellite imaging often misses [1]. This data supports climate and biodiversity goals on agricultural lands [1].

The framework transforms complex pixel data into clear planning tools for environmental projects [1]. This launch coincides with the company's 2026 AI responsibility plan, which focuses on governing technology at scale [2]. By identifying small landscape elements, the tool helps policymakers protect vital ecosystems [1].
